The deaths of so many of their comrades and their excessive consumption had gradually cooled the two parties’ heads, restoring their ability to reason. Now, both sides no longer completely disregarded their safety and were fighting in a cautious and reserved manner.
Seeing this development, after having spectated for so long, Yang Kai couldn’t help feeling a bit disappointed.
If no one else died, he couldn’t reap any benefits, so staying here any longer would just be a waste of time.
As such, he quietly left the asteroid he was hiding behind and prepared to continue on his way while processing the Soul remnants of the dozen or so Saint King Realm cultivators he had previously absorbed.
Both groups of cultivators were far too busy dealing with their remaining opponents so no one noticed him.
After the time it would take to make a cup of tea, Yang Kai was already a few hundred kilometres away from the battlefield and was preparing to summon out his Star Shuttle when a subtle yet mysterious energy fluctuation behind him suddenly caught his attention.
Yang Kai quickly turned around just in time to see a bright light flash amidst the field of asteroids, one that faded and disappeared as quickly as it had appeared.
Yang Kai stopped as a look of astonishment appeared on his face. The energy fluctuation just now gave him a very familiar feeling; it was clearly a fluctuation due to the manipulation of space. In other words, it is very likely that someone had torn space at the point where he had spotted the flash of light.
This discovery immediately drew Yang Kai’s attention. It had been a few years now since he came to the Star Field and he had learned that out of the nearly infinite number of cultivators out there, those proficient in the Dao of Space were incredibly few.
The Dao of Space itself was an esoteric field of study, one that was difficult to become introduced to, and even more difficult to master. As for reaching the pinnacle of comprehension, that was neigh impossible.
Having inadvertently stumbled upon such a location related to the Dao of Space, Yang Kai was inclined to explore it to see who the person who tore space was and whether or not he could hold a dialogue with them, preferably gaining an opportunity to learn from one another.
Releasing his, Divine Sense, Yang Kai soon swept the area in front of himself all the way up to the previous battlefield, yet to his surprise, he found no human figures in the place from a moment ago, only a faint distortion in space.
[What happened?]
Yang Kai couldn’t repress his curiosity and decided to rush back and investigate more thoroughly.
After a short while, Yang Kai once again arrived at the previous battlefield and looked around. There was indeed no one here, the several cultivators who had been fighting up until a moment ago all seemingly having disappeared, with no bodies or corpses nearby.
Yang Kai followed the distortion in space to a mountain-sized asteroid upon which a gate-like structure had been built. This gate was extremely simple, and at first glance was obviously quite old. Also of note was the fact that this gate was covered in a thick layer of Space Spirit Crystals.
